Reviewers checking changes to the Gallerion audio-guide app should verify that exhibit playlists are fetched through the offline cache layer, since galleries in the Hollowmere wing have no signal. Any change touching the sync scheduler requires a smoke run on a physical device. Record the resulting build token, shown below, in your review.

pipeline stamp: htk9_ce63042d9

## Runbook: Ormwick legacy ORM refactor

The Ormwick data layer is being migrated to the new Fieldline mapper in phases. During the transition, some entities read through the old path and write through the new one, so brief inconsistencies in admin views are expected and self-heal within minutes. Don't file data-corruption tickets for these. The phase schedule and affected entities are tracked on the internal page here.

operations page: https://jira.qorvelsys.internal/browse/pages/browse/pages

# Venton Partnership — Term Sheet Overview

**Access: Managers only**

Quick rundown for branch managers: Venton Logistics sent over their term sheet last week and it's broadly in line with what we discussed at the Ashgrove offsite. Three-year exclusivity on the Quillport corridor, volume rebates kicking in at tier two, and a joint marketing pot. Legal is still chewing on the termination clauses. The strategic reasoning sits below.

management briefing: Istaelix Group is in early talks to buy Sorysax Logistics for about $496.2 million. The Kasox launch date is October 3, and nothing goes to the press before then. Legal wants the Norokax Foods term sheet withdrawn before April 25.

Meeting notes, weekly eng sync: the Harborline fleet fuel-usage report showed a 4% discrepancy between pump logs and telematics data for the Westmarsh depot. We agreed the aggregation job likely double-counts refuels spanning midnight; a fix will be validated against October data before the next board review. Follow-up analysis, corrected figures, and the revised report are owed by the person named below.

approver of tagef-hawef = Oliok Julath